// REINDEX_BATCH_CAP limits docs per shard pass in the Tallowfield
// nightly search reindex. Raising it starves the ingest queue;
// lowering it overruns the maintenance window. 5000 is the tested
// sweet spot. Change only with a soak run. Verified against the
// build noted below.

session token of bawif-hahog = htk6_ac5981

Handover Note — Warranty Cost Overrun, Drayfield Line

To: incoming director, from outgoing. For branch manager distribution.

Warranty claims on the Drayfield compressor line ran 34% over budget this half. Root cause: seal supplier change in March. Claims processing is current; reserve topped up. Supplier remediation underway with Kelvast Components. Keep branch comms limited to the repair protocol — nothing on sourcing decisions. Broader direction is set out in the confidential note that follows.

board note of kageg-bahof: The renewal with Holwynax Holdings closes at $2 million a year, 5 percent below the last contract. Project Ulaath slips by two quarters because of the supplier delay.

- [ ] Step 7: Archive cold storage buckets (Glacierline tier). Confirm both ceremony witnesses are present, verify bucket manifests match the Oxbow ledger, then seal the archive key shares. Plugin authors may observe but not handle shares. Once sealed, the archive index itself is encrypted and can only be reopened with the passphrase below.

vault phrase of badup-hahig = tamael-aldael-kelmir-istael-fenok-istwyn-tamius-jorath-oliion

## Artifact Signing — Consent Banner Rollout

All builds of the Lantrey consent banner must be signed before the rollout pipeline accepts them. The Quillmark CI runner handles signing automatically, but contractors pushing hotfixes from a local machine need to sign manually using the team's release key. Verify your build against staging first. The current signing key is below.

signing key of bagap-yawep = bky13_TbfT6ZMUoGJo2